> I haven't heard a clear consensus that we'd like to move the net time yet, so I've still been launching the net at 6PM. I don't mind scheduling it earlier in the evening if that would get us better propagation, though that also increases the chance that I'll miss the net due to running errands.
> 
> Tom W6TOM suggested that if we fail to make contact on AM next time, we might try SSB. So, next Saturday, if (probably when!) we fail to make contact via AM, I'm open to pressing the upper sideband button and trying again. Yeah, some other hams might get bent out of shape that we're using USB instead of LSB on 75m, but a lot of the green/gray rigs are USB-only.
> 
> So, next weekend, if you hear USB chatter at 3985, flip over to USB or turn on the BFO, because it might be MRCG folks. 73 until then!
